Sometimes it meant painting rooms or repairing tables and chairs. Often, it was simply spending time with the children and trying to make them happy.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cThat was his passion,\u201d his older brother, Ramin Heyratian, told Iran International\u2019s <a target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noindex nofollow noopener\" class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__link\" href=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/watch?v=Ox0A3ExAflw&amp;t=230s\">Eye for Iran<\/a>. \u201cIf one virtue was supposed to define a person, it is his kindness.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">A playwright and screenwriter, Afshin also helped friends write productions without receiving credit because of restrictions imposed on him, according to Ramin, who said this was his brother\u2019s third imprisonment<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">A life interrupted<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">His latest ordeal began after he was questioned at the school where he volunteered. Security forces came to the family home on November 11, 2025, and arrested him.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Agents confiscated phones, tablets, computers, Baha\u2019\u00ed books and even Baha\u2019\u00ed pictures hanging on the walls, according to his brother.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Afshin then spent 34 days in solitary confinement. For the first days after his arrest, his family did not even know where he was.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Eventually, he was permitted to call his mother and tell her to prepare the deed to the family home, raising hopes that it could be used as collateral for his release.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">The release never came.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Ramin said Afshin remained imprisoned for more than 260 days before being charged, while his mother was repeatedly sent between courts trying to find out what was happening.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cThey were sending her back and forth almost every day,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Afshin had an opportunity to build a life outside Iran in the early 2000s and spent time in the United States, but ultimately chose to return.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cHe truly loves Iran and Iranians,\u201d Ramin said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">The case has drawn international condemnation. Nobel Peace Prize laureate Shirin Ebadi has called for his release, while the Canadian government described his treatment as an example of Iran\u2019s \u201ccontinued disregard for human rights.\u201d.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u2018No lawyer, no warning\u2019<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">The ordeal has been particularly devastating for Afshin\u2019s mother, an 80-year-old cancer survivor.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">She can now visit her youngest son approximately once every two or three weeks, Ramin said. Afshin is also allowed to telephone her each day.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Ramin said the family had been told Afshin would receive legal representation and that they would be notified before his court date.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Neither happened.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Instead, one of Afshin\u2019s fellow prisoners alerted his own family that Afshin had been taken to court. Afshin\u2019s mother learned what was happening while she was on her way to an oncology appointment.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">She rushed to the courthouse.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Ramin said she waited in the hallways, trying to determine where her son was, until she suddenly heard Afshin behind her as he emerged from court.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">By then, the hearing was over.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Afshin pleaded not guilty but had no lawyer representing him, Ramin said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cHe was basically his own lawyer,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">When his mother asked how he was doing, Afshin reassured her.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cI\u2019m okay. Don\u2019t worry about it. We\u2019ll be fine,\u201d Ramin recalled him saying.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u2018Life sentence\u2019<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Branch 26 of the Tehran Revolutionary Court sentenced Heyratian to prison terms totaling 31 years, according to the Hengaw Organization for Human Rights.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">The sentences included 12 years for \u201cforming an illegal group,\u201d 11 years for \u201cpropaganda activities contrary to the sacred law of Islam,\u201d six years for \u201cassembly and collusion,\u201d and two years over allegations of \u201cobtaining illegitimate property.\u201d Financial penalties were also imposed.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Under Article 134 of Iran\u2019s Islamic Penal Code, only the most severe sentence, 12 years, is expected to be enforceable.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Ramin rejects the allegations against his brother.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">\u201cThe things that they have attached to those charges \u2026 are, first of all, completely untrue,\u201d he said, adding that the organization where Afshin volunteered had been permitted to operate in Iran.<\/p>\n<p class=\"CustomPortableTextComponents-module-scss-module__peBeZa__paragraph\">Iran\u2019s Baha\u2019\u00ed community has faced decades of state persecution and restrictions on education, employment and other aspects of public life.
